Structural lifting services involve the careful raising and support of a building or specific parts of a property to address foundational or structural issues. This process typically uses specialized equipment to lift, stabilize, and sometimes relocate sections of a building safely and precisely. It is a practical solution for homeowners facing challenges such as uneven floors, cracked walls, or shifting foundations, helping to restore stability and prevent further damage. By lifting and supporting the structure, these services can provide a solid foundation for repairs or renovations, ensuring the property remains safe and functional.

Many problems that structural lifting services help solve are related to settling or movement of a property’s foundation. Over time, homes may experience uneven settling due to soil conditions, moisture changes, or aging materials. This can lead to issues like sloping floors, misaligned door and window frames, or cracks in walls and ceilings. Structural lifting can correct these issues by realigning the building’s foundation or supporting compromised areas. This service is also useful when a property requires modifications, such as adding new levels or installing heavy equipment, where additional support is necessary to maintain safety and stability.

Properties that typically use structural lifting services include older homes, commercial buildings, and properties with known foundation problems. Older houses, especially those in areas with expansive clay soils like parts of Louisville, KY, are prone to shifting and settling, making lifting and stabilization necessary. Commercial buildings that need reinforcement to support renovations or new construction also benefit from these services. Additionally, properties that have experienced damage from natural events or ground movement may require structural lifting to restore safety and prevent further deterioration. The overview below groups typical Structural Lifting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Louisville, KY.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or structural lifting tasks like leveling a sagging porch or lifting a small section of foundation,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the scope and accessibility of the project.

Moderate Projects - Medium-sized lifts, such as raising a cracked basement wall or stabilizing a leaning chimney, us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common and often involve more complex equipment or techniques.

Large-Scale Lifting - Larger, more complex projects like lifting an entire building section or significant foundation stabilization can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more. Fewer projects reach this tier, typically requiring extensive planning and specialized equipment.

Full Replacement or Major Work - Complete structural replacements or extensive foundation overhauls can exceed $20,000, with many such projects reaching into the $50,000+ range. These are less common and involve comprehensive assessments and customized solutions by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of structures can benefit from structural lifting services? Structural lifting services can assist with a variety of structures including residential buildings, commercial facilities, bridges, and industrial equipment to ensure proper support and stability.

How do professionals handle the safety aspects of structural lifting? Local contractors follow standard safety procedures and use appropriate equipment to minimize risks during lifting operations, prioritizing safety throughout the process.

What equipment is typically used for structural lifting projects? Common equipment includes cranes, hoists, jacks, and lifting slings, selected based on the size and weight of the structure being lifted.

Can structural lifting services be used for foundation repairs? Yes, structural lifting can be part of foundation repair projects, helping to stabilize and reposition foundations as needed.

How do service providers ensure the stability of a structure after lifting? After lifting, contractors often reinforce or modify the structure to maintain stability and ensure it remains secure over time.
